FTP concurrent connections on RHEL 5.2 server


Hi,
Gentlemen. Is there any limitation of concurrent ftp connections that can run on the RHEL 5.2 server? I cannot find out the answer yet. Thanks.

Hi,

You didn't say what ftp server you're running, but if it's the default vsftpd, check the "max_clients" option in vsftpd.conf
